England vs France Lineups: Analyzing Player Formations in the Football Clash
England National Football Team Lineup:
– Goalkeeper: Jordan Pickford
– Defenders: Kyle Walker, John Stones, Harry Maguire, Luke Shaw
– Midfielders: Kalvin Phillips, Declan Rice, Mason Mount
– Forwards: Raheem Sterling, Harry Kane (C), Phil Foden
France National Football Team Lineup:
– Goalkeeper: Hugo Lloris (C)
– Defenders: Benjamin Pavard, Raphael Varane, Presnel Kimpembe, Lucas Hernandez
– Midfielders: N’Golo Kante, Paul Pogba, Adrien Rabiot
– Forwards: Antoine Griezmann, Kylian Mbappe, Karim Benzema
Key player matchups to watch:
– Harry Kane vs Raphael Varane: A battle between one of the best strikers in the world and a top-notch defender.
– Raheem Sterling vs Benjamin Pavard: Sterling’s pace and dribbling skills against Pavard’s defensive abilities.
– Kalvin Phillips vs N’Golo Kante: Two hard-working midfielders who will be crucial in controlling the game.
Formation analysis:
– England is likely to line up in a 4-3-3 formation, with a strong attacking trio of Sterling, Kane, and Foden.
– France, on the other hand, may opt for a 4-3-3 formation as well, with a deadly front three of Griezmann, Mbappe, and Benzema.
Tactical considerations:
– England will look to dominate possession and create chances with their attacking firepower.
– France’s midfield trio of Kante, Pogba, and Rabiot will aim to control the game and provide service to their lethal front three.
